The long-awaited second-generation Tesla Roadster is slated for its unveiling on October 1st, with Tesla utilizing rocket-launch visuals and incorporating technology from Elon Musk's SpaceX.

First prototyped in November 2017 with ambitious performance claims, the Roadster's production timeline has been repeatedly delayed since its initial 2020 target. Recent announcements on X, accompanied by a countdown clock on Tesla's order page, confirm the new October 1st deadline and an exclusive event for reservation holders in Waco, Texas.

The production Roadster has undergone significant redesign, moving away from Model S Plaid components to an all-new carbon-fiber hypercar platform. The highlight is expected to be the "SpaceX package," featuring cold-gas thrusters inspired by SpaceX's Falcon 9 program. Musk claims this package could propel the Roadster to 60 mph in approximately 1.1 seconds and theoretically allow it to lift off the ground. However, the thruster-equipped variant might be limited to track use and potentially not street legal.
